概括
耳部创伤后,可以发生格拉登尼戈综合征 (GS),影响头骨神经V和VI. 及时诊断和治疗导致一个儿科病例完全康复.
科学领域:
- 耳鼻喉科 耳鼻喉科 耳鼻喉科
- 儿科神经学 儿科神经学
- 传染性疾病 传染性疾病
背景情况:
- 格拉登尼戈综合征 (GS) 是中耳炎的一种罕见并发症.
- 它涉及到感染扩散到石顶部,可能会影响头骨神经V和VI.
- 穿透耳朵的创伤是GS的不寻常原因.
研究的目的:
- 报告一个罕见的儿科格拉登尼戈综合征病例.
- 突出突破性创伤作为枪伤的触发因素.
- 强调早期诊断和多学科管理.
主要方法:
- 一个5岁男孩的案例介绍,他患有创伤后的GS.
- 临床评估,包括神经评估.
- 图像研究:CT用于石骨侵蚀,MRI用于脑膜增大.
- 用抗生素和透气管进行治疗.
主要成果:
- 患者出现了严重的耳朵疼痛,耳,水平双眼视 (VI神经麻) 和半面部低听力 (V神经麻).
- 扫描显示了石骨侵蚀;MRI显示脑膜增强没有.
- 通过抗生素治疗和通风管实现了完整的临床解决.
结论:
- 穿透耳朵的创伤可以在儿童中引发格拉登尼戈综合征.
- 早期的临床怀疑和及时的成像对诊断至关重要.
- 多学科的方法确保了复杂的耳炎的成功管理.
